How to be a unicorn [electronic resource]. Matt Huntley.
A brand-new LEGO® Little Golden Book about the importance of being yourself! Sandy isn’t like the other kids in her town—she loves to wear her unicorn costume all the time. People think she’s odd. But when there’s a mystery that only she can solve, they see the power of Sandy’s creativity and teamwork. The combination of two classics—LEGO® Minifigures and Little Golden Books—makes this sweet and silly story perfect for kids ages 4 and up, and collectors of all ages!
